John Henry Jensen, age 76 of Herman, also known as Hank, passed away May 5, 2026, at Methodist Hospital in Omaha, Nebraska. A memorial service will be held Saturday, May 23 at the Herman American Legion at 10:00AM. Graveside services will follow in the Herman Cemetery.

John was born on January 25, 1950, in Fremont, Nebraska, the son of John and Ruth Jensen. He was raised on the family farm outside of Herman, Nebraska, and attended Thone Country School. He later attended High School in Herman and graduated in 1968.

On July 22, 1970, he was united in marriage to Diane K Adams in Bridgeport, Nebraska. John was hired as a carpenter and later started his own construction company, Jensen Construction, building homes, a business his three sons later became a part of. He retired from the construction company in 2016, and John and Diane moved back to Herman from Omaha. John was a craftsman through and through; his passion for woodworking, mechanics and history were admired by many.

John leaves his wife Diane of Herman; sons: Matthew (Hope) of Wahoo, Nebraska, Cory (Nicole) of Bennington, Nebraska and Jeremy of Herman, Nebraska; grandchildren: Madelyne, Lucas, Evan, Breanne, Austin, Owen and Hallie; sisters: Betty Heinssen, Marie Rager and Valerie Petersen; along with nieces, nephews, extended family and friends.

He was preceded in death by his parents, children: Luke and Effie and sister Marian McCluskey.
